Geocache Description:

This big tree survived the massive July 15, 2012 mud slide. The original cache container (a nano) (and now bigger than a nano) was replaced after a squirrel took it? The Bolero comes from the Bolo tie hanging on nearby tree. Enjoy the Dance. Someone liked the Bolo tie so they took it... probably not a cacher. Before the mud slide this tree was relatively hidden and the bolo tie not exposed to hikers on trail.


This is a picture of the waterfall before the destruction. The waterfall is a couple of hundred feet to the East from the cache site.

No longer a nano, its a 3 inch long tube, so ignore hints in older logs, ie 2015 </>
